Staff Picks 2009Here are our top 5 recommendations!

WorshipMusic.com's staff is more than just employees that clock in and out everyday. We are worship musicians, leaders and songwriters serving in our local churches each week. A few of us have gathered up a short list of our top 5 favorite CDs from this year. We hope you enjoy the recommendations!



Jeremy - General Manager

1."Songs From Jacob's Well I & II" by Mike Crawford and his Secret Siblings - "Loaded with scripture, this ground-breaking CD signals that Indie folk/rock worship has come of age."

2."Those Who Dream" by Kristene Meuller - "Kristene displays the tender side of Jesus Culture music in these well crafted songs."

3."Glorious" by Paul Baloche - "Paul's albums are reliable and loaded with solid songs; much like a well-stocked tool box for worship leaders."

4.The Embers by The Embers - "Inspiring songwriting flows from this Kentucky worship community."

5."Heaven Came Down" by Marie Barnett - "A nice blend of modern roots music, perfectly fitting vocals and seasoned songwriting."


Marc - Fulfillment Manager

1."Those Who Dream" by Kristene Mueller - "A strikingly beautiful and intimate album from a fresh new talent out of the Jesus Culture movement."

2."Faith + Hope + Love" by Hillsong - "Finally, a near-perfect convergence of the aesthetics of the mainstream Hillsong church and Hillsong United."

3."Ancient Skies" by Michael Gungor Band - "Artsy rock-n-worship that's eccentric but accessible, while lyrically still managing to uplift, encourage and exhort."

4."We Shall Not Be Shaken" by Matt Redman - "Redman's best full-length album to date, with a lyrical focus on our shortcomings and where God fills in the gaps."

5."Be Quiet" by Rita Springer And Paulette Wooten - "A nice departure from Rita's usual style; an album that does require you to slow down, be quiet and absorb it."


Mike - Marketing Assistant

1."Songs From Jacob's Well I & II" by Mike Crawford and his Secret Siblings - "Mike Crawford brings unique and interesting music with strong lyrics to create something a little different from your typical worship album."

2."Church Music" by David Crowder Band - "David Crowder Band's latest album is a great combination of electronic elements with modern rock and worship."

3.The Embers by The Embers - "I love the songs 'Cloud by Day' and 'Glory, Honor, Power, Praise'."

4."Consumed" by Jesus Culture - "Consumed offers great songs for both corporate and personal worship."

5."Relentless" by Misty Edwards - "Misty's passion and talent to lead worship make 'Relentless' a great addition to my collection."
